I do not have a Windows Domain Controller. I have a Novell 4.11 File Server with about 12 XP Pro Clients with Novell 4.90 client for Windows.

I want to set the local security, what the user can do, view control panel, change background etc. However, is there a way that I can copy those settings and pass them to other clients.

Could someone please assist, I am getting grey hair over it. I read the Group Policy help in Windows XP but was difficult to follow.
 
My choice:

For local security policies only:
See here for one more way: Use a copy of the Registry.pol file configured as you want. Copy the Registry.pol file that is located in the %Systemroot%\System32\GroupPolicy\User folder to the same folder on other systems.
